错误:获取渠道背书客户端的错误

时间:2018-10-09 09:11:28

标签: docker hyperledger-fabric hyperledger

我已经下载了最新版本v1.3.0-rc1的结构样本和二进制文件。

在第一个网络中,使用以下命令:-

./byfn.sh up -c mychannel -s couchdb

对等无法加入频道。输入以下错误:-

  
    

让所有对等方加入频道...

         

对等频道加入-b mychannel.block

         

res = 1

         

设置+ x

         

错误:获取渠道认可者客户端的错误:认可者客户端无法连接到peer0.org1.example.com:7051:创建新连接失败:超出了上下文期限

  

谢谢。

2 个答案:

答案 0 :(得分:0)

您可以查看此document来与多个同位体一起运行结构,因为启动时应使用以下命令

CTTblWidth width = table.getCTTbl().addNewTblPr().addNewTblW();
width.setType(STTblWidth.DXA);
width.setW(new BigInteger(size + ""));

while -a选项在某些问题上不适用于最新分支,因此您应该检查上面文档中指定的分支。

答案 1 :(得分:0)

首先检查您的密码生成工具(您在路径中设置的密码工具)是否是您在示例中使用的工具,这种情况通常指向旧版本工具。

强烈建议您重新启动所有操作以清理所有正在运行的容器

./byfn.sh -m down
docker stop $(docker ps -a -q)
docker rm $(docker ps -a -q)

然后重新运行启动命令./byfn.sh -c mychannel -m up -s couchdb -a

如果仍然有问题,也许可以从一个简单的示例开始,我想出了如何使用基本网络示例设置Fabric(v1.2)和两个不同的主机。

Setup hyperledger fabric in multiple physical machines

希望有帮助!